Marta Chinnici graduated in Mathematics (2004) magna cum laude at the University of Naples (Italy), where she received her PhD in Mathematics and Computer Science (2008) with a thesis on stochastic self-similar processes and applications in non-linear dynamical systems. Currently, she is a Senior Researcher at the ENEA’s Department of Energy Technologies and Renewable Energy Sources, ICT Division, where she works on ICT for Energy Efficiency issues. She is a European Commission Expert in the field of ICT and a review/evaluator for several European programs on the same topic. She is Member of Technical Programme Committees of various international conferences and workshops, and Editor/Referee of relevant journals in the fields of computer science, data science and energy. To date, she authored more than 50 scientific articles and books, and presented in leading national and international conferences on ICT and energy topics.
Florin POP is professor at the Department of Computer and Information Technology, the Politehnica University of Bucharest. He also works as a 1st degree scientific researcher at National Institute for Research and Development in Informatics (ICI) Bucharest. His general research interests are: distributed systems (design and performance), grid computing and cloud computing, peer-to-peer systems, Big Data management, data aggregation, information retrieval and classification techniques, Bio-inspired optimization methods.
Cǎtǎlin NEGRU is a system engineer and researcher at the Department of Computer and Information Technology at University Politehnica of Bucharest (UPB). He obtained his PhD from UPB in 2016. His research interests include distributed systems, energy efficiency, cloud storage, cyber- physical systems, GIS. His research has led to the publishing of numerous papers and articles at prestigios journals and conferences. He is involved in several national and international research projects.
